The Radium women were being woman manufacturing unit staff who contracted radiation poisoning from portray enjoy dials with self-luminous paint.
The inventor of radium dial paint, Dr Sabin A. Von Sochocky, died in November 1928, getting the 16th known target of poisoning by radium dial paint. He experienced gotten Ill from radium in his arms, not the jaw, nevertheless the situation of his Dying helped the Radium Girls in courtroom.
U.S. Radium Company hired somewhere around 70 Girls to perform various duties together with dealing with radium, even though the house owners as well as the experts knowledgeable about the effects of radium diligently prevented any exposure to it click here themselves; chemists in the plant used guide screens, masks and tongs. U.S. Radium experienced dispersed literature for the clinical Local community describing the “injurious results” of radium.
in the urging of the companies, employee deaths have been attributed by clinical gurus to other will cause. Syphilis, a infamous sexually transmitted an infection at some time, was frequently cited in attempts to smear the reputations on the Girls.

The brushes would eliminate shape after a couple of strokes, And so the U.S. Radium supervisors inspired their employees to place the brushes with their lips, or use their tongues to keep them sharp. since the real mother nature on the radium had been retained from them, the Radium ladies painted their nails, tooth, and faces for enjoyable Along with the fatal paint developed within the factory. a lot of the employees grew to become sick; it is actually unidentified the amount of died from publicity to radiation.
Among the very first to view numerous difficulties amid dial painters ended up dentists. Dental suffering, unfastened enamel, lesions and ulcers, as well as failure of tooth extractions to recover were Many of these ailments. lots of the Gals afterwards began to are afflicted by anemia, bone fractures, and necrosis from the jaw, a affliction now called radium jaw. The women also suffered from suppression of menstruation, and sterility. It is believed the X-ray machines employed by the health-related investigators may have contributed to a lot of the sickened staff’ unwell-wellness by subjecting them to further radiation.
It turned out a minimum of on the list of examinations was a ruse, Portion of a campaign of disinformation started off from the protection contractor. U.S. Radium and also other observe-dial corporations turned down statements the troubled workers were being suffering from exposure to radium. For some time, Medical doctors, dentists, and researchers complied with requests from the companies to not release their info.
